    C1 Rear Springs

    Just checking to see if anyone has seen any rear springs with the ends of the leaves other than square. I have both ends of one short leaf which look to be ground off and the front of a third leaf and rear of one of the second longest leaves seemingly altered. There is no pattern. Two leaves from one side and one from the other. I was sure that a PO had done it, but then I saw a picture in Bob Baird and Tom Howey's book which looks exactly like the rear of my "altered" second leaf. All of the ends have that little curve that they are supposed to have. I can't imagine why this would be done; by GM or by a PO. It's a '62. Has anyone seen anything like this? Thanks!

                Re: C1 Rear Springs

                Gary,

                Back in the day, to counter act the rear springs saging, lots of people would add the 5th leaf to raise the rear end.

                Stencil marks indicate an after market replacement spring.

                      Re: C1 Rear Springs

                      Comparing to my 4 leaf 62, rough measurements, the small leaf on the 5-leaf spring is shorter than my small leaf on my 4-leaf 62 while the next leaf on the 5-leaf appears to measure close to the small leaf on my 62. Also, the long leaf on the 5-leaf is not grooved while the other 4 are grooved and of course the long leaf on my 4-leaf 62 is fully grooved.
